Transaction dfeba8348f69bb33ba714f2c5a191dbfa6d199007a42c7dff6afdb0da78bf3b6
1 Input
1 Output
-
dfeba8348f69bb33ba714f2c5a191dbfa6d199007a42c7dff6afdb0da78bf3b6:0
- value
- 66643
- script pubkey
- OP_0 OP_PUSHBYTES_20 8809c897a93a3de81f4f29edbe24931cf56b2278
- address
- bc1q3qyu39af8g77s86098kmufynrn6kkgnc4es4rx